hi guys, i finally got my hands on the P9 for my 960, i have a question regarding parts for this engine. what other brand's conrod i can replace it with if i need replacement? from what i remember the Mega DSII, and the IDM is based on the P9 (P7R), but are there any difference in terms of the conrod? can you provide the part number and also where to get one from?

thanks
amuse is offline  
Old 06-12-2008 | 03:23 PM
  #124  
duneland's Avatar
Tech Elite
 
Joined: Sep 2004
Posts: 2,403
From: NW Indiana, USA
Default

DS2 rod fits. I just put one in mine. MEG202170.

Just picked up a P9 Evo 2 and was wondering about the plug.
When I looked for plugs I noticed that the #7 plug comes in both a long body and a short body (at least from nova).
Can someone tell me the correct plugs I should order.
tdr170 is offline  
Old 01-30-2009 | 10:43 AM
  #133  
Team Kamikaze's Avatar
Tech Champion
iTrader: (3)
 
Joined: Apr 2006
Posts: 8,868
From: 我的名字是沈先生。我是中国人, 居住美国
Default

Originally Posted by tdr170
Just picked up a P9 Evo 2 and was wondering about the plug.
When I looked for plugs I noticed that the #7 plug comes in both a long body and a short body (at least from nova).
Can someone tell me the correct plugs I should order.
There is only one #7 PICCO plug which is a cold plug, use only PICCO PLUG is the correct plug, you can click the web link on my signature and order PICCO Plug from the website.
Team Kamikaze is offline  
Old 01-30-2009 | 10:47 AM
  #134  
Tech Addict
iTrader: (4)
 
Joined: Jan 2005
Posts: 530
From: Miami
Default

Originally Posted by tdr170
Just picked up a P9 Evo 2 and was wondering about the plug.
When I looked for plugs I noticed that the #7 plug comes in both a long body and a short body (at least from nova).
Can someone tell me the correct plugs I should order.
Like kamikaze said Picco only has one style plug, you can run Picco/Sirio/IDM they are the same tappered conical,wich ever one is easier for you to get..
